Update 14/11/08 

St Josephs Primary School (85%) was the winner of the National Walk to School Day Bike. Followed very closely by Warrnambool Primary, Allansford and St Johns. This bike will be presented to the St Josephs Primary School. Well done to everyone for their efforts!
